Lindberg Sci-Fi US Moon Ship model kit 1/96 : $13.75
Kit# 602 This conceptual spacecraft was heavily influenced by the work of Dr. Werner von Braun. Designed for purely non-atmospheric flight, it eschewed the wings and other sleek aerodynamic features of the V-2-inspired rocketships of its era in favor of a purely functional \"Tinker Toy\"-like design that placed practicality over aesthetics. Conceived several years before photovoltaic solar cells were perfected, this Moon Ship nonetheless enjoyed the benefits of inexhaustible solar power thanks to a gimbaled reflector that heated a gas tube from which electricity could be generated. First released in 1958 as the \"US Moon Ship,\" this model was subsequently re-released in the late 1960\'s as the \"Mars Probe Landing Module,\" then again in the 1970\'s as the \"Star Probe Space Shuttle.\" It was ultimately re-released by Glencoe Models in the 1990\'s as the more appropriately named \"Lunar Lander\". The U.S.Moon ship was also released by Lindberg in the mid-50s as part of a 5-kit \"Spaceships of the Future\" collector\'s set. This is a \"Mars Probe\" edition from the 1970\'s.
